At the Phillips Brooks House, the Student Christian Council of Greater Boston will hold a conference this Sunday from 9 to 4 o'clock. This meeting will be attended by the United Christian movement, composed of representatives of all churches in the vicinity of Boston, and from all the Greater Boston college Christian associations, including Radcliffe, Wellesley, M.I.T., B.U., and Harvard.
During the morning session, Sherwood Eddy will speak, and at 11 o'clock the conference will break up into discussion groups. After luncheon, Dr. Hugh Vernon White, of the Congregational Board, will head discussion.
